About This Book

What if a simple mission to borrow a magical ring turned into a whirlwind adventure through time? Imagine dodging Vikings, outsmarting the Minotaur, and sneaking through Napoleon’s court—all to save Mouse Island! But can Geronimo and his friends reach King Solomon in time to restore harmony?

Quick Assessment

This middle-grade adventure follows Geronimo and his friends as they time travel to retrieve a magical ring believed to restore balance to their home, Mouse Island. Along the way, they encounter historical figures and mythical challenges that provide exciting learning opportunities about history and mythology. Suitable for ages 9-12, the story features mild peril and fantasy elements without intense violence or mature themes.

Why we rated No time to lose 12LP

No time to lose is written at a Level 7 reading level across 310 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 8.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, No time to lose works for readers up to grade 9.0.

We rate No time to lose as 12LP ("Light — Physical")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ly mild;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.

Thematically, No time to lose explores adventure, fantasy world-building, historical, friendship, and quests —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
